Why is China building a 100 MW solar power plant in Kyrgyzstan?
Kemin, Kyrgyzstan — In a significant step toward enhancing Kyrgyzstan’s energy infrastructure, China has begun construction of a 100 MW solar power plant in the city of Kemin, located in the Chuy Region. The project underscores Kyrgyzstan’s commitment to sustainable energy development and environmental preservation.

Why does Kyrgyzstan use a lot of electricity?
After Kyrgyzstan gained its independence, residential power consumption rose significantly due to intensive use of electricity for heating and cooking.

How much energy does a solar flat plate water heating system use?
Installing a solar flat plate water heating system for your home can reduce your energy consumption by as much as 40% to 50%. It only takes 1 or 2 solar flat plates to heat over 80 gallons of hot water per day - all for free. Many people don't realize how much energy is used just to provide hot water in your home.

Are 500 watt solar panels bigger?
500-watt solar panels are bigger than your average solar panel. Typically made up of 144 half-cut monocrystalline cells, their large size makes 500-watt solar panels more commonly seen in commercial, ground-mounted, and utility solar projects. For residential solar projects, is bigger always better? That’s not necessarily the case.

Are 500 watt solar panels suitable for residential spaces?
However, as we will explain later, 500-watt solar panels are not yet optimal for residential spaces. This is because the existing variety of 500-watt solar panels is still relatively large — 72 cells spanning 2.2 meters by 1.1 meters. This makes them more suitable for large commercial and industrial setups.
